Output b728c99793845f2f9efbaa175f7df7ccf041efbf80da79494d53e150ce49d5da:1

value
28580805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38e966f70d1ff18973e5adca7c886477a38bf48e OP_EQUAL
address
36swNMbZZ2iF8CoafeJvNQSHHDjrmZ3aza
transaction
b728c99793845f2f9efbaa175f7df7ccf041efbf80da79494d53e150ce49d5da
confirmations
511398
spent
true